Las Vegas - what time of year is best?

Haven't been for 20 years! Who flies there and from where (I need lgw, lhr or bmx)? How far in advance do you need to book shows? When is best to go when it is not too hot? Lots of ??????????????

    Off the top of my head, If you want to fly non stop then Virgin is your only option(someone will correct me if i am wrong). Sometimes cheaper to get a return to LA and internal flight return to vegas.

    Loads of options if you want a connecting flight (all the US carriers).

    Weather...I have been in March April and May and always had good weather all be it very windy when we went in march. The May trip a few years ago it was 110 every day, and it can get much hotter than that in the summer months, and quite cold in the winter months especially at night.

    I dont know much about shows, except the one night specials obviously get booked up quickly, but the long running shows are always available( i think), and if you wait till the day there are two or three discount ticket booths about on the strip.

    We go March/April and October, usually fly from Manchester with Delta via Atlanta, but this time we are going with US Airways via Philadelphia.

    March can be warm and a bit windy, April is hotter
    October is the nicest month for weather, should be still in the eighties,November was cooler,but the hours of sunlight were less and it got dark earlier.

    We drive down to Laughlin, which is much nicer and friendlier than Vegas and about ten degrees warmer, also the average midweek price is about $24
    (Vegas is fine for a few days just to see everything)

    There is lots of live entertainment in the Laughlin casinos, although you don't get the big names of today in the shows, think Engelbert and you get some idea.
